Tart

Pronunciation: /ˈtɑːrt/

Tart (noun)

  1. A small pie with a sweet filling like fruit or custard.
  2. An offensive term for a woman who is thought to be immoral.

Examples

  • The bakery sells a delicious fruit tart.
  • She baked a lemon tart for dessert.

Common collocations: bake a tart, fruit tart, lemon tart, tart flavor, tart taste

Tart (adjective)

  1. Having a sharp, sour taste, like a lemon.
  2. Being bold or cheeky in a playful way.

Examples

  • The lemonade has a tart flavor.
  • Green apples are often tart.
